How to write an appreciation letter to a departing employee Think about your time with the employee. Customize and personalize your message. Thank the employee. Ask the employee to stay in touch. Wish them luck on their next opportunity. Sign your name.

What is a RIF letter? A reduction in force letter is used to notify an employee they have lost their job due to major company changes such as budget cuts, acquisitions, and restructuring.
